Rosselkhoznadzor: to speak about the return of certain countries and enterprises to the Russian market, is too early
"To talk about what the odds are, from what countries and what companies have the access to the Russian market, it is premature. This is a multifaceted issue", - said the assistant head of the Rosselkhoznadzor, Vasily Lavrovsky on the sidelines of the Russian-Greek forum in Thessaloniki on Friday.
According to him, Rosselkhoznadzor interacts with the Supervisory services of Greece, checks businesses so that after the abolition of bradenburg they could immediately return to the Russian market.
"A pretty serious range of Greek companies were checked. Now the main issue is to make them correct the mistakes, what they haven’t, unfortunately, done yet," he said.
As V. Lavrovsky considers, the issue of returning foreign suppliers will also depend on the price situation, the needs of the Russian market, which vary in connection with the saturation of its domestic products and products from countries that have not fallen under the Russian embargo.
Currently, because of the food embargo Greece as a EU member cannot deliver meat and meat products, fish and fish products, milk and dairy products, vegetables and fruits to Russia. The ban was introduced on 7 August 2014 and extended until the end of 2017.
